Product Description
Degradation Performance
First-year power degradation: 1%.
Annual linear power degradation: 0.4%.
Compared with p-type PERC modules, the first-year power generation gain is approximately 1%.
High-Temperature Power Generation Performance
With a relatively low temperature coefficient and lower module operating temperature, the power generation gain under high-temperature conditions is about 1.5%-2%.
Bifacial Power Generation Performance
The bifacial ratio is approximately 10% higher than that of p-type modules. Under different ground conditions, the power generation gain ranges from 0.8% to 1.2%.
Low-Irradiance Power Generation Performance
Under irradiance conditions of 600 W/m² or below (e.g., in the early morning or evening), the measured power generation gain is approximately 0.2%.
Over a 30-year lifecycle, the total power generation gain is about 1.8%.
